    CHAPTER 12
    Installing Configuring and
    Uninstalling Components in a
    Novell NetWare SAN


    This chapter provides instructions installing configuring and uninstalling software
    components required for connecting Dell PowerVault 650F and 651F storage systems
    to a Dell PowerEdge or Compaq server running the Novell NetWare operating system
    All procedures in this document require administrator access permissions

    This chapter describes a NetWare configuration that requires Dell OpenManage Data
    Managed Node for NetWare to be installed on at least one of the NetWare servers
    see Figure 4 1

    This chapter describes procedures for the following components

    Windows management station for a NetWare SAN
    QLogic Fibre Channel Configuration Utility
    Dell OpenManage Application Transparent Failover for NetWare
    Dell OpenManage Data Managed Node for NetWare
    Dell OpenManage PowerSuites for Tape Backup
    NOTE To install the Windows NT or Windows 2000 based data management soft
    ware see Chapter 11 Installing Configuring and Removing Microsoft Windows
    SAN Software Components



    Setting up a Windows Management
    Station for a NetWare SAN
    Before you begin verify that you have the latest Dell supported Service Packs and
    clients installed on your servers and management station You must set up a
    Microsoft Windows management station system for installation of the following
    software packages

    QLogic Fibre Channel Configuration Utility
    Dell OpenManage Data Management Station



    support dell com Installing Configuring and Uninstalling Components in a Novell NetWare SAN 12 1
    Dell OpenManage Data Administrator
    Dell OpenManage Data Analyzer
    Dell OpenManage Data Organizer
    NOTES You will use the Windows NT or Windows 2000 management station as a cli
    ent to the SAN The system that you use as the management station does not need
    to be part of the SAN However the management station must it be part of the LAN
    to which the SAN servers are attached You should use the same system that you plan
    to use to monitor the SAN because you will need to use some of the applications for
    both installation and management purposes

    For information about installing Data Management Station Data Administrator Data
    Analyzer and Data Organizer see Chapter 11 Installing Configuring and Removing
    Microsoft Windows SAN Software Components These components use the Data
    Managed Node software that you install on your NetWare server and must be
    installed after Data Managed Node has been installed



    QLogic Fibre Channel Configuration Utility
    NOTICE Before installing the QLogic Fibre Channel Configuration Utility
    you must install the HBA and ensure that its firmware is at the latest level
    For information about installing the HBA and HBA firmware see Install
    ing Host Bus Adapters in Servers in Chapter 10

    The Qlogic Fibre Channel Configuration Utility is used to maintain a list of World Wide
    Names WWNs on both Windows and NetWare systems and to enable proper opera
    tion of Storage Consolidation on Windows systems

    NOTE You must run the QLogic Fibre Channel Configuration Utility each time the
    hardware on the SAN changes to create the appropriate settings for the replaced
    device

    NOTICE The following procedures assume that you are performing an
    initial installation These procedures vary if any of the components are
    already installed on the system

    NOTES For a NetWare SAN installation run the QLogic Fibre Channel Configuration
    Utility setup process on a Windows NT or Windows 2000 system that is network
    connected to all NetWare servers

    You must have the latest Dell supported NetWare client loaded and running on the
    Windows NT or Windows 2000 management station

    To install the QLogic Fibre Channel Configuration Utility for NetWare you must install
    it on the Windows NT or Windows 2000 management station first and then on all
    NetWare servers

Device Manager Codes: Information on how to repair the faults below is listed in our forums
Error Code 1 This device is not configured correctly (Code 1)
Error Code 2 Windows could not load the driver for this device because the computer is reporting two <type> bus types (Code 2)
Error Code 3 The driver for this device may be bad, or your system may be running low on memory or other resources (Code 3)
Error Code 4 This device is not working properly because one of its drivers may be bad, or your registry may be bad (Code 4)
Error Code 5 The driver for this device requested a resource that Windows does not know how to handle (Code 5)
Error Code 6 Another device is using the resources this device needs (Code 6)
Error Code 7 The drivers for this device need to be reinstalled (Code 7)
Error Code 8 This device is not working properly because Windows cannot load the file <name> that loads the drivers for the device (Code 8)
Error Code 9 This device is not working properly because the BIOS in your computer is reporting the resources for the device incorrectly (Code 9)
Error Code 10 This device is either not present, not working properly, or does not have all the drivers installed (Code 10)
Error Code 11 Windows stopped responding while attempting to start this device, and therefore will never attempt to start this device again (Code 11)
Error Code 12 This device cannot find any free resources to use (Code 12)
Error Code 13 This device is either not present, not working properly, or does not have all the drivers installed (Code 13)
Error Code 14 This device cannot work properly until you restart your computer (Code 14)
Error Code 15 This device is causing a resource conflict (Code 15)
Error Code 16 Windows could not identify all the resources this device uses (Code 16)
Error Code 17 The driver information file <name> is telling this child device to use a resource that the parent device does not have or recognize (Code 17)
Error Code 18 The drivers for this device need to be reinstalled (Code 18)
Error Code 19 Your registry may be bad (Code 19)
Error Code 20 Windows could not load one of the drivers for this device (Code 20)
Error Code 21 Windows is removing this device (Code 21)
Error Code 22 This device is disabled This device is not started. (Code 22)
Error Code 23 This display adapter is functioning correctly This device is not started. (Code 23)
Error Code 24 This device is either not present, not working properly, or does not have all the drivers installed (Code 24)
Error Code 25 Windows is in the process of setting up this device (Code 25)
Error Code 26 Windows is in the process of setting up this device (Code 26)
Error Code 27 Windows cant specify the resources for this device (Code 27)
Error Code 28 The drivers for this device are not installed (Code 28)
Error Code 29 This device is disabled because the BIOS for the device did not give it any resources (Code 29)
Error Code 30 This device is using an Interrupt Request IRQ resource that is in use by another device and cannot be shared (Code 30)
Error Code 31 This device is not working properly because <device> is not working properly (Code 31)
Error Code 32 Windows cannot install the drivers for this device because it cannot access the drive or network location that has the setup files on it (Code 32)
Error Code 33 This device isn't responding to its driver (Code 33)
Error Code 34 Windows cannot determine the settings for this device (Code 34)
Error Code 35 Your computer's system firmware does not include enough information to properly configure and use this device (Code 35)
Error Code 36 This device is requesting a PCI interrupt but is configured for an ISA interrupt (Code 36)
Error Code 37 Windows cannot initialize the device driver for this hardware (Code 37)
Error Code 38 Windows cannot load the device driver for this hardware because a previous instance of the device driver is still in memory (Code 38)
Error Code 39 Windows cannot load the device driver for this hardware The driver may be corrupted or missing (Code 39)
Error Code 40 Windows cannot access this hardware because its service key information in the registry is missing or recorded incorrectly (Code 40)
Error Code 41 Windows successfully loaded the device driver for this hardware but cannot find the hardware device (Code 41)
Error Code 42 Windows cannot load the device driver for this hardware because there is a duplicate device already running in the system (Code 42)
Error Code 43 Windows has stopped this device because it has reported problems (Code 43)
Error Code 44 An application or service has shut down this hardware device (Code 44)
Error Code 45 Currently, this hardware device is not connected to the computer (Code 45)
Error Code 46 Windows cannot gain access to this hardware device because the operating system is in the process of shutting down (Code 46)
Error Code 47 Windows cannot use this hardware device because it has been prepared for "safe removal", but it has not been removed from the computer (Code 47)
Error Code 48 The software for this device has been blocked from starting because it is known to have problems with Windows (Code 48)
Error Code 49 Windows cannot start new hardware devices because the system hive is too large exceeds the Registry Size Limit) (Code 49)
